templates: add filter to reverse list The filter supports only lists because for lists, it’s straightforward to implement. Reversing text doesn’t seem very useful and is hard to implement. Reversing the bytes would break multi-bytes encodings. Reversing the code points would break characters consisting of multiple code points. Reversing graphemes is non-trivial without using a library not included in the standard library.

/// Write `contents` into a temporary file, then rename to `relative_path`.
/// This makes writing to a file "atomic": a reader opening that path will
/// see either the previous contents of the file or the complete new
/// content, never a partial write.
pub fn atomic_write(
&self,
relative_path: impl AsRef<Path>,
contents: &[u8],
) -> Result<(), HgError> {
let mut tmp = tempfile::NamedTempFile::new_in(self.base)
.when_writing_file(self.base)?;
tmp.write_all(contents)
.and_then(|()| tmp.flush())
.when_writing_file(tmp.path())?;
let path = self.join(relative_path);
tmp.persist(&path)
.map_err(|e| e.error)
.when_writing_file(&path)?;
Ok(())
